James Livesay papers relating to the liberation of Nordhausen
The records relate to James Livesay's experiences at the liberation of Nordhausen (a.k.a. Dora, Dora-Mittelbau): an original photograph that Livesay took during the burial of the camp's inmates accompanied by a brief testimony of Livesay's; two 1945 newspaper clippings from a West Virginia newspaper, "The Register," describing the activities of Livesay and the 104th U.S. Infantry Division; a copy of a "Witness to the Holocaust" questionnaire distributed by Emory University's Center for Research in Social Change that Livesay filled out to describe his war-time experiences, including those which led to his subsequent psychological problems; and photocopies of photographs of dead Nordhausen prisoners.
